Kick or Twitch: The Streamer's Platform Dilemma Ignites Debate

Share:

The streaming world is abuzz with a familiar question echoing through Reddit communities: "Kick or Twitch?" A recent thread on r/streaming encapsulates the ongoing dilemma faced by countless content creators weighing their options between the industry giant and its newer, controversial challenger. This choice isn't merely a preference but a strategic career decision, impacting potential earnings, audience reach, and the very future of their digital presence.

Twitch, with its dominant market share and established viewer base, offers unparalleled visibility but often comes with a less favorable revenue split. Kick, on the other hand, tempts streamers with a significantly higher percentage of subscription revenue and a seemingly more lenient approach to content moderation, appealing to those seeking greater financial independence or a fresh start. However, Kick's smaller, albeit growing, audience and ongoing reputation concerns present their own set of challenges.

Ultimately, the decision boils down to individual priorities: a steady, large audience versus better monetization and potentially more creative freedom. Streamers are meticulously evaluating platform features, community guidelines, and long-term sustainability to navigate this evolving landscape, proving that the competition between these platforms is far from settled.
